Transaction 3bb395dd7fa1a76897f29999765a583da3e159dc404b8614b270aed8e1441ec7
1 Input
2 Outputs
- 3bb395dd7fa1a76897f29999765a583da3e159dc404b8614b270aed8e1441ec7:0
- 3bb395dd7fa1a76897f29999765a583da3e159dc404b8614b270aed8e1441ec7:1
value 76140000
address 18WTU6VNDUiCimChcA6xLU26ayStTMo4rH
value 158054600
address 1sY3UhL3Uen35rHZP6utUkEWoCJmChYhB